Mass at Notre Dame was short and simple. One reading was even in English. We stayed after Mass to take some time to walk around the cathedral and admire the beautiful stained glass and architecture. After our tour we stepped outside to find that the crowds had returned in full force to fill the square in front of the church. It had also started to rain. We only encountered a brief drizzle on one other stop on our trip (the morning we left Florence). Getting a bit soaked, we waited in line to climb the bell towers made famous by Victor Hugo and his Hunchback of Notre Dame. Once up the stairs we were greeted by various gargoyles and picturesque views of a rain soaked Paris. As we left Notre Dame and headed back toward our hotel, we got to hear the famous church bells ringing.
